The six phases

From first call to live launch

  1. PHASE 01

    Discovery & strategy

    We start with a 30-minute call, then a written brief. We map your goals, audience, competitors and conversion path. We agree on KPIs — leads, ranking keywords, AOV, LTV — before any code is written.

    Duration: 1–2 weeks

    Deliverables

    • Project brief (1-page written doc)
    • Goals & KPIs (with measurement plan)
    • Target audience personas
    • Competitor audit (3–5 direct, 3–5 aspirational)
    • Conversion path map
    • Scope, timeline, fixed price proposal

    Communication

    • 30-minute call (Loom, Zoom or Google Meet)
    • Written brief delivered within 48 hours
    • Async Q&A via Slack or email
  2. PHASE 02

    Architecture & planning

    Wireframes, information architecture, URL structure, internal linking strategy, schema markup plan, content outline. We document every decision so the build is mechanical, not exploratory.

    Duration: 1–2 weeks

    Deliverables

    • Sitemap & URL structure
    • Low-fidelity wireframes for every key page
    • Information architecture diagram
    • Internal linking strategy
    • Schema markup plan (JSON-LD)
    • Content outline for every page
    • Tech stack & integration map

    Communication

    • Figma or PDF wireframes
    • Asana or Linear project board
    • Loom walkthrough of the plan
  3. PHASE 03

    Design system & UI

    High-fidelity Figma designs with reusable components, type scale, color, spacing, motion, responsive breakpoints. You review and approve before we write a line of code.

    Duration: 2–3 weeks

    Deliverables

    • High-fidelity Figma designs for every key page
    • Reusable component library (buttons, inputs, cards, navigation)
    • Type scale, color palette, spacing tokens
    • Motion principles & microinteraction spec
    • Responsive designs (320px → 2560px breakpoints)
    • Accessibility-checked contrast & focus states
    • Figma handoff file with developer annotations

    Communication

    • Figma file with edit access
    • Asynchronous feedback rounds (up to 2 included)
    • Weekly 30-minute design review call
  4. PHASE 04

    Build & integration

    Hand-coded in Next.js / React / TypeScript / Tailwind. CMS integration, third-party APIs, analytics, payment, forms. You get a private staging URL to review at every milestone.

    Duration: 4–12 weeks (varies by scope)

    Deliverables

    • Hand-coded Next.js / React / TypeScript application
    • CMS integration (Sanity, Contentful, Strapi or headless WP)
    • Schema markup (JSON-LD)
    • Technical SEO foundations (sitemap, robots.txt, canonicals)
    • Performance optimization (Lighthouse 90+ target)
    • Accessibility foundations (WCAG AA)
    • Analytics, Search Console, heatmaps installed
    • Private staging URL on every milestone

    Communication

    • Two-week sprint cycles
    • End-of-sprint demo (live or Loom)
    • Daily Slack updates
    • Linear project board with real-time status
  5. PHASE 05

    QA, security & performance

    Cross-browser testing, device testing, accessibility audit, Lighthouse audit, schema validation, security review, load testing. Nothing ships until it scores 90+ on every metric.

    Duration: 1–2 weeks

    Deliverables

    • Cross-browser QA report (Chrome, Safari, Firefox, Edge)
    • Cross-device QA report (iOS, Android, tablets, desktops)
    • Lighthouse audit: 90+ across Performance, SEO, Accessibility, Best Practices
    • WCAG AA accessibility audit
    • Schema markup validation (Google Rich Results Test)
    • Security review (OWASP Top 10)
    • Load testing (for SaaS and high-traffic sites)
    • Bug-fix log with severity and resolution

    Communication

    • QA report delivered as PDF + Notion
    • Bug fixes included in scope (up to 3 rounds)
    • Sign-off document for production launch
  6. PHASE 06

    Launch, handover & growth

    Domain cutover, Search Console submission, sitemap submission, monitoring, on-call runbook, recorded video walkthrough, written documentation, 30–90 day bug-fix warranty. Optional ongoing retainer.

    Duration: 1 week + 30–90 day warranty

    Deliverables

    • Domain cutover (with zero-downtime plan)
    • Search Console + Bing Webmaster Tools verified
    • Sitemap submitted and indexed
    • Analytics, conversion tracking, heatmaps verified
    • Monitoring, alerting, on-call runbook
    • Recorded video walkthrough (30+ min)
    • Written documentation (architecture, content editing, troubleshooting)
    • 30-day (Starter) / 60-day (Growth) / 90-day (Scale) bug-fix warranty
    • Optional ongoing maintenance or growth retainer

    Communication

    • Launch day Slack channel for 24-hour on-call support
    • Weekly check-ins for 30 days post-launch
    • Monthly retainer reviews (if applicable)

FAQ

Process questions, answered

01How long does a typical project take?
A focused marketing site: 4–6 weeks. A custom Shopify or e-commerce build: 6–10 weeks. A custom web application or SaaS MVP: 8–16 weeks. A full SaaS product: 4–9 months. We give you a fixed timeline in the proposal and stick to it. We also offer 1-day VIP Design Sprints for time-critical rebuilds.
02What if I want to change the scope mid-project?
Changes are scoped, priced, and added to the timeline in writing before work begins. We use a 'change order' process: you describe the change, we estimate the cost and timeline impact, you approve, then we proceed. This protects both of us from surprise costs and timeline slips.
03Do I own the code, design files, and intellectual property?
Yes. You own 100% of the source code, design files, brand assets, and intellectual property. Code lives in your GitHub organization from day one. We sign an IP assignment on final payment. No proprietary lock-in, no template fees, no exit costs.
04What if I'm not happy with the work?
We work in fixed milestones with written briefs, so there's no ambiguity about what we're delivering. If we're consistently missing the brief, we redo the milestone at no cost. If after the second revision you're still not happy, we refund the milestone. We don't get there often, but the policy exists for your protection.
05How do you handle communication?
Async-first, with strategic synchronous calls. Daily Slack updates, weekly Loom demos, bi-weekly sprint reviews. We overlap with US, UK and UAE timezones for live calls. Most clients find they get more responsive communication than with US-based agencies.
06What happens after launch?
Every project includes a 30–90 day post-launch bug-fix warranty. After that, we offer monthly maintenance retainers starting at $79/month and growth retainers for ongoing SEO, GEO, content and CRO. We also provide a recorded video walkthrough, written documentation, and a 30-day Slack channel for launch support.
